論文名稱: 介白素-33影響新生兒肺部介白素-4誘發的第二群自然類淋巴球細胞亞群發育
IL-33 affects the IL-4-induced development of group 2 innate lymphoid cell subpopulations in neonatal lungs

  • 新生兒時期肺泡化階段中大量的介白素-33是由第二型肺泡細胞所分泌。介白素-33可促進肺部第二型免疫反應和第二群自然類淋巴球發育。過去研究中發現介白素-4可以誘導一群能分泌介白素-10的第二群自然類淋巴球於小鼠肺部環境中。然而,介白素-10分泌型第二群自然免疫類淋巴球細胞是否能被誘導以及受介白素-33的調控於新生兒肺部仍然未知。因此,我們想要探討介白素-33在新生兒肺部自然類淋巴球族群發展中的調控角色。我們使用流式細胞儀去區分自然類淋巴球細胞族群、骨髓細胞族群,以及檢測第二群自然類淋巴球細胞相關功能的細胞激素於野生型和介白素-33缺乏的小鼠肺部中。我們發現第二型免疫細胞的數量顯著降低於出生後7至28天的介白素-33缺乏的小鼠相較於野生型小鼠。然而,第二群自然類淋巴球佔自然類淋巴球的比例在介白素-33缺乏和野生型小鼠肺部中則相差不多。新生時期肺部介白素-4和介白素-10的量在介白素-33缺乏的小鼠中相較野生型小鼠來得低。流式細胞儀分析新生野生型小鼠的肺部有較多的介白素-10分泌型第二群自然類淋巴球數量相較於介白素-33缺乏的小鼠。肺部分選出的新生鼠第二型自然類淋巴球,而非成鼠第二型自然類淋巴球,在IL-33存在下可受到介白素-4和視黃酸的刺激後轉群成介白素-10分泌型第二群自然類淋巴球。我們的結果強調新生兒肺部肺泡化階段中介白素-33扮演促進分泌介白素-10的第二群自然類淋巴球分化的角色。過去研究已發現肺部介白素-10分泌型第二群自然類淋巴球在過敏性疾病中扮演免疫抑制的角色,因此受介白素-33刺激的介白素-10分泌型第二群自然類淋巴球在新生兒時期的肺部發育可能對於未來維持肺部免疫穩定狀態有其重要性。

    Abundant Interleukin-33 (IL-33) is produced by alveolar type 2 cells during lung alveolarization phase in the neonatal stage. It triggers lung type 2 immune response and facilitate group 2 innate lymphoid cell (ILC2) development. IL-4 has been found to induce regulatory IL-10-producing ILC2s in the lung environment of mice. However, it is still unknown whether IL-10-producing ILC2s are induced in neonatal lungs and regulated by IL-33. Therefore, we aimed to investigate the regulatory role of IL-33 in the development of lung innate lymphoid cell (ILC) populations during neonatal period. We used flow cytometry to characterize ILC populations, myeloid cell populations and measured the cytokines relevant to ILC2 functions in the lungs of WT and IL-33-/- mice. We found that the numbers of type 2 immune cells significantly decreased in the lungs of IL-33-/- mice from around PND7 to PND28 when compared with WT mice. However, the proportion of ILC2s in the total ILCs was comparable in lung between WT and IL-33-/- mice. The whole lung cytokine levels of IL-4 and IL-10 were lower in IL-33-/- mice when compared with WT mice during the neonatal period. The numbers of IL-10-producing ILC2 cells were found more in the neonatal lungs of WT mice than in IL-33-/- mice, as determined by flow cytometry analysis. Lung sorted neonatal ILC2s, but not adult ILC2s, could be induced by IL-4 and retinoid acid (RA) to differentiate to ILC2-10 in the presence of IL-33. Our results highlight the role of IL-33 in promoting the differentiation of ILC2s towards IL-10-producing ILC2s in lung during the neonatal alveolarization phase. Since ILC2-10 cells have been found to play an immune suppressive role in allergic diseases, the development of ILC2-10 cells induced by IL-33 in lung during the neonatal period may be important to maintain lung homeostasis throughout life.
